我是Android新手。
当我从TextView中选择任何项时,如何动态更改Spinner的文本。
当做。
我使用的代码

    private Spinner paidIn = null;
     paidIn = (Spinner) findViewById(R.id.paidIn);
ArrayAdapter<CharSequence> adapter = ArrayAdapter.createFromResource(
                 this, R.array.currencies, android.R.layout.simple_spinner_item);
         adapter.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
         paidIn.setAdapter(adapter);


     paidIn.setOnItemSelectedListener(new OnItemSelectedListener() {

                    @Override
                    public void onItemSelected(AdapterView<?> arg0, View arg1,int arg2, long arg3)
                    {
                        setStrTypeExpense(); // my Function, i want to call to change Textview
                    }
                }

最佳答案

尝试此代码

mSpinner.setOnItemSelectedListener(new OnItemSelectedListener() {

    @Override
    public void onItemSelected(AdapterView<?> arg0, View arg1,int arg2, long arg3)
    {
         textView.setText(mSpinner.getSelectedItem().toString());
    }
}

10-07 12:09